Stabilizing the Boat Conformation of Cyclohexane Rings

Siddharth Dasgupta, Yongchun Tang, J. Michael Moldowan, Robert M. K. Carlson, William A. Goddard III

1995J. Am. Chem. Soc., 117(24), 6532-653426cited

Abstract

In calculating the energetics for various conformers of the A, B, and C series of hopanoid hydrocarbons present in mature oil reservoirs, we find that the B series prefers the boat conformation (by 1.3-2.5 kcal/mol) for the D cyclohexane ring (see Figures 1 and 2). We analyze the structural elements responsible for stabilizing this boat conformation, identify the key features, and illustrate how one might stabilize boat conformations of other systems.
